Wat Arun, also known as the Temple of Dawn, is a Buddhist temple located in Bangkok, Thailand. It sits on the western bank of the Chao Phraya River and is famous for its stunning and distinctive architectural design. The temple's prang, a tower built in Khmer architectural style, is more than 80 meters high and is the highest in Thailand.

The Khlong Lat Mayom Floating Market is only open on weekends and public holidays, with opening hours between 8am and 5pm. It can get quite busy, so we recommend visiting earlier in the day so that you can explore the market when it’s quieter.

If you don’t fancy an early start then it’s a good idea to visit Khlong Lat Mayom Floating Market at around lunchtime. There are plenty of food stalls selling delicious local dishes for extremely reasonable prices, so it’s ideal if you’re looking for a good value lunch!

Although the market can get quite busy at times, in our experience it was more busy with local tourists. Unfortunately it can be quite hard to avoid the crowds as the market is only open a few days a week, and so it’s regularly busy from around 10am onwards.

Grand Palace

The Grand Palace is a complex of buildings that served as the royal residence from 1782 to 1925. It is a stunning example of Thai architecture and houses the Emerald Buddha.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Pad Thai

Stir-fried rice noodles with eggs, tofu, shrimp, and a sweet and tangy sauce, garnished with crushed peanuts and lime.

Dinner Can be made vegetarian or vegan.

Tom Yum Goong

A spicy and sour shrimp soup with lemongrass, kaffir lime leaves, galangal, and chili.

Dinner Contains seafood.

Som Tum

A spicy green papaya salad made with shredded papaya, tomatoes, green beans, peanuts, and a tangy dressing.

Lunch/Snack Can be made vegetarian or vegan.

Mango Sticky Rice

Sweet ripe mango served with sticky rice and coconut milk.

Dessert Vegetarian.

Safety Information

Overall Safety Rating: Exercise caution

Bangkok is generally safe for tourists, but petty crime, scams, and traffic accidents can occur. Be cautious of your surroundings, especially in crowded areas and at night.

Important Precautions:
  • • Be cautious of strangers approaching you with offers or requests.
  • • Avoid unlicensed taxis and tuk-tuks.
  • • Be wary of jet ski rentals and gem shops.

Day trips

Ayutthaya
80 km from Bangkok • Full day

Ayutthaya is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and the former capital of the Kingdom of Siam. It is known for its stunning temples and historical ruins.

Damnoen Saduak Floating Market
105 km from Bangkok • Half day to full day

Damnoen Saduak is one of the most famous floating markets in Thailand, offering a unique shopping and dining experience on the water.

Maeklong Railway Market
80 km from Bangkok • Half day to full day

Maeklong Railway Market is a unique market where vendors set up their stalls on the railway tracks, and a train passes through several times a day.
